开启新时代数据库数据轻松加入Redis缓存(数据库数据写入redis)
2023-06-13 09:11:10 时间
近年来,随着数据量的不断增加,数据库的管理越来越复杂,耗费的资源也越来越多,这就要求时刻更新和优化数据库,才能有效的提供服务。在这样的背景面对日益增长的访问量,要想提高数据库的性能,Redis缓存就显得尤为关键了。
Redis缓存是一个高性能的key-value数据存储系统,具有数据类型丰富、支持多种数据结构、可以水平扩展、实时操作性能高等特点,能够满足不断增长的性能需求,可以作为后端来缓存数据,大大提高了服务器和应用程序的响应速度和吞吐量。
Redis缓存能有效的提高应用性能,其实大家可以将Redis看成一个缓存数据库,将常用的数据存储到Redis中,而不是每次都从数据库中读取,这样就能够实时操作数据,节约时间,提高数据库性能。
要想将Redis与数据库进行对接,需要使用适当的API对象和相关类,像工厂模式这样的设计模式就比较适合,可以这样想:将实现Redis数据库操作和MySQL数据库操作的类封装,然后通过工厂类提供针对Redis数据库和MySQL数据库的操作,然而在实现这种设计模式的过程中,大家可以使用的API方法有:RedisTemplate,ConnectionFactory,LettuceConnectionFactory,JdbcTemplate等。
例如,以下是使用RedisTemplate查询Redis数据库数据的代码:
String value = (String) redisTemplate.opsForValue().get("key1");
System.out.println(value);
开启一个新的时代,Redis缓存能将数据库的数据轻松的加入,大大的提升了传统的数据库的性能,为用户提供更好的体验。虽然实现起来有一定的难度,但掌握了相关知识之后,就可以驾驭Redis缓存,来满足不断增长的性能需求了。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 开启新时代数据库数据轻松加入Redis缓存(数据库数据写入redis)
相关文章
- 深入Redis缓存:查看实时数据(查看redis缓存的数据)
- Redis:加速你的内存数据库(redis内存数据库)
- Redis队列高并发实现(redis队列实现高并发)
- 提升Redis写入性能的方法(redis写入性能)
- 轻松实现Redis数据库的在线安装(redis在线安装)
- 深入探索利用Redis查看数据库(查看redis的数据库)
- 本地Redis连接失败排查原因与解决方法(本地的redis连不上)
- Redis加把密安全体验强化(有密码的redis)
- 深入揭秘支持Redis协议数据库(支持redis协议数据库)
- 提升程序性能,为何不用Redis缓存(为什么使用redis缓存)
- Yum安装Redis最快速的安装体验(yum redis 下载)
- 何以利用单机部署实现Redis分区(单机redis如何分区)
- 如何快速掌握Redis缓存查看技巧(怎么查看缓存redis)
- 使Redis数据库最大限度发挥优势(使用redis数据库优势)
- 低版本Redis上的分布式锁实现(低版本redis分布式锁)
- 极速运行将商城首页数据缓存在Redis中(商城首页存到redis中)
- 情况Redis集群强势上线,节点构建无压力(redis 集群节点上线)
- 精通Redis集群实战环境部署指南(redis集群环境实战)
- Redis阻塞队列实现实时数据同步的利器(redis阻塞队列教学)
- 红色之火对Redis通讯模式的研究(redis通讯模式)
- Redis连接服务器稳定高效的数据库存储方案(redis 连接到服务器)
- 性使用Redis实现数据库一致性(redis跟数据库一致)